Transaction 6475d5526507ffa88caa2c9df37424c80b02b3ae6373e6a25b017114c2ff74a1
1 Input
1 Output
-
6475d5526507ffa88caa2c9df37424c80b02b3ae6373e6a25b017114c2ff74a1:0
- value
- 298207222
- script pubkey
- OP_0 OP_PUSHBYTES_20 38d2a5d14ff405e12ec279dc6731a9c9372f896c
- address
- bc1q8rf2t5207sz7ztkz08wxwvdfeymjlztv7qera9